Dependency status is worth 19% here. That is a status your finance office determines, not a box you tick — and it is the single largest lever on this page that is not a change of address.

None of it is taxed. $3,297 a month of BAH takes more than $3,297 of basic pay to match, which is why comparing a civilian salary against military base pay alone understates the gap.

Things the rate table doesn't tell you
01
“With dependents” is a dependency status, not a marital status. A single member paying child support can be authorized BAH-Diff; a married dual-military couple with no children is not automatically the with-dependents rate for both. If your situation is unusual, your finance office decides — not this table.
02
O-8, O-9 and O-10 draw the same BAH as O-7. The table stops there for a reason, not because it is missing rows.
03
This is CONUS BAH only. Overseas is OHA, which works differently — it reimburses actual rent up to a cap, with separate utility and move-in allowances. Alaska and Hawaii are BAH; Germany, Japan and Korea are OHA.
